What Schwarz Digits actually added
On September 18, Schwarz Digits, the technology and IT arm of Schwarz Group, the German conglomerate behind Lidl and Kaufland, announced it had integrated Celonis and Snowflake into its STACKIT sovereign data and AI ecosystem. Techzine reports that Snowflake's AI Data Cloud now runs on STACKIT with data stored in Apache Iceberg format and encryption keys retained within EU infrastructure, meaning Schwarz controls the keys even though it is running a third party's platform on top of its own cloud. That is a structurally different arrangement than simply buying Snowflake as a SaaS product, since STACKIT sits underneath as the sovereign hosting and key-management layer rather than the other way around.
The addition builds on prior integrations with SAP through RISE with SAP, plus security vendors Zscaler and CrowdStrike, and joins Celonis for process intelligence. Martin Frederik, Snowflake's Benelux country manager, described the underlying motivation directly: "Data sovereignty ultimately revolves around freedom of choice." A Dutch sovereign cloud deployment is expected to follow in mid-2027, extending the model beyond Germany into a second major EU market and signaling this is a multi-year platform strategy rather than a single national compliance project.
Why a grocery company is building cloud infrastructure at all
It is easy to read this as a story about Snowflake or Celonis expanding their European footprint, but the more interesting actor is Schwarz Group itself. This is a grocery and retail conglomerate that decided, years ago, to build and operate its own sovereign cloud platform rather than simply buying whatever sovereignty product AWS, Microsoft, or Google offered. STACKIT is now mature enough that other major software vendors want to run on top of it.
That is a meaningfully different posture than most retailers take toward infrastructure. Schwarz treated data sovereignty as a strategic capability worth owning rather than a compliance checkbox to purchase from a hyperscaler, and it is now monetizing that decision by hosting other vendors' platforms. For a CIO at a retail or CPG company operating across US and EU jurisdictions, this is a live example of vertical integration into infrastructure paying off at a scale most peers assumed was only available to hyperscalers themselves.
The compulsion risk that is driving this, explicitly
The stated rationale is grounded in a specific, concrete concern rather than abstract data protection philosophy: US legislation that can compel American cloud and software providers to hand over customer data regardless of where that data is physically stored. That risk applies to any EU company running workloads on a US hyperscaler, even one with a European data center, because the legal exposure follows the company's headquarters, not the server's location. A German grocery conglomerate is unusually exposed to this concern given how much supplier, pricing, and customer data it processes daily across its Lidl and Kaufland banners.
STACKIT's answer is retaining encryption key control within EU infrastructure even when the software layer, Snowflake in this case, is American. That architecture, keys held locally, software hosted on sovereign infrastructure, is becoming the reference pattern for regulated European buyers who need US vendors' functionality without the compulsion exposure. The certification stack that makes this credible, not just marketing
Sovereignty claims are cheap to make and hard to verify, which is why the certification list matters more than the press release language surrounding it. Both Snowflake and STACKIT hold C5 certification from Germany's BSI federal security agency, plus ISO 27001 for information security, ISO 42001 specifically for AI management systems, and PCI-DSS for payment data. That combination gives a procurement or security team a concrete audit trail rather than a vendor's self-description of how seriously it takes sovereignty, and it gives a CIO a specific checklist to hand to their own compliance team when a European regulator or customer asks for proof.
ISO 42001 is the detail worth noting specifically, since it is one of the first AI-specific management system certifications to see real adoption, and its presence here signals that AI governance auditing is becoming table stakes for any vendor selling into regulated European retail and CPG buyers, not just a differentiator for the most cautious enterprises. What this means for your own multi-cloud AI strategy
The Schwarz model argues for a specific answer to a question every large retailer is currently facing: whether to consolidate AI and data workloads onto a single hyperscaler's sovereign offering, or build a neutral sovereign layer and invite multiple best-of-breed vendors onto it. STACKIT chose the latter, and the fact that Snowflake, Celonis, and SAP have all now integrated suggests the model is working well enough to attract serious platform partners rather than just niche European vendors.
For US-headquartered retailers with EU exposure, the practical takeaway is to start separating the sovereignty question from the vendor selection question. You do not need to abandon Snowflake, SAP, or any other preferred platform to satisfy EU data residency and compulsion concerns, provided you can architect key custody and data locality independently of which software vendor sits on top. That separation is exactly what STACKIT has now proven out at scale.
